GoogleContainerTools/skaffold · error

couldn't get kubectl minor version: %w

Error message

couldn't get kubectl minor version: %w

What it means

CompareVersionTo runs `kubectl version` via c.Version(ctx) and parses Major/Minor with strconv.Atoi to compare against a required version. When the Major string is not a plain integer, the parse error is wrapped — note the message misleadingly says 'minor version' even for the Major failure (a copy-paste bug in the error text).

Source

Thrown at pkg/skaffold/kubectl/version.go:71

// CheckVersion warns the user if their kubectl version is < 1.12.0
func (c *CLI) CheckVersion(ctx context.Context) error {
	comp, err := c.CompareVersionTo(ctx, 1, 12)
	if err != nil {
		return err
	}

	if comp < 0 {
		return errors.New("kubectl version 1.12.0 or greater is recommended for use with Skaffold")
	}
	return nil
}

func (c *CLI) CompareVersionTo(ctx context.Context, vMajor, vMinor int) (int, error) {
	v := c.Version(ctx)

	majorInt, err := strconv.Atoi(v.Major)
	if err != nil {
		return 0, fmt.Errorf("couldn't get kubectl minor version: %w", err)
	}

	// Some patched versions get a '+' suffix.
	minorInt, err := strconv.Atoi(strings.TrimRight(v.Minor, "+"))
	if err != nil {
		return 0, fmt.Errorf("couldn't get kubectl minor version: %w", err)
	}

	if majorInt > vMajor {
		return 1, nil
	}
	if majorInt == vMajor {
		if minorInt > vMinor {
			return 1, nil
		}
		if minorInt == vMinor {
			return 0, nil
		}

Solutions

  1. Run `kubectl version --client` and confirm it prints numeric major/minor values
  2. Install a standard upstream kubectl matching your cluster and put it first on PATH
  3. If using a forked kubectl whose version has suffixes, switch to upstream or update Skaffold

Example fix

// before: forked kubectl prints Major="v1" -> Atoi fails
// after: install upstream kubectl so Version() returns Major="1", Minor="27"
kubectl version --client=true -o json | jq -r '.clientVersion.major'
Defensive patterns

Strategy: validation

Validate before calling

out, err := exec.Command("kubectl", "version", "--client", "-o", "json").Output()
if err != nil {
    return fmt.Errorf("kubectl unavailable: %w", err)
}
var v struct{ ClientVersion struct{ Major, Minor string } }
if json.Unmarshal(out, &v) != nil || v.ClientVersion.Major == "" {
    return errors.New("kubectl returned non-standard version output; install upstream kubectl")
}

Type guard

func validKubectlVersion(major, minor string) bool {
    _, err1 := strconv.Atoi(major)
    _, err2 := strconv.Atoi(strings.TrimRight(minor, "+"))
    return err1 == nil && err2 == nil
}

Try / catch

cmp, err := cli.CompareVersionTo(ctx, 1, 20)
if err != nil {
    var perr *strconv.NumError
    if errors.As(err, &perr) {
        return fmt.Errorf("kubectl version output unparseable (%s); reinstall upstream kubectl: %w", perr.Num, err)
    }
    return err
}

Prevention

When it happens

Trigger: kubectl's reported Major version string is non-numeric: empty output (kubectl missing/failing), error/usage text instead of version info, or forked kubectl builds emitting suffixed versions like "1" with annotations the parser doesn't expect.

Common situations: kubectl not on PATH or failing to execute so Version returns empty fields; vendor/patched kubectl (GKE, Rancher, OpenShift forks) printing non-standard version strings; stale PATH entry pointing at a broken kubectl.
